1. 计算机科学导论
- 主题句:本章节旨在为初学者提供一个计算机科学的基本框架和入门指导。
- 知识点:
- 计算机发展史
- 计算机硬件与软件的基本概念
- 计算机程序设计的基本原理
- 数据结构与算法简介
2. 程序设计基础
- 主题句:本章节深入探讨程序设计的核心概念,包括算法和数据结构。
- 知识点:
- 基本编程语言(如C、Python)的学习
- 控制结构(顺序、选择、循环)
- 函数与过程
- 基本数据结构(数组、链表、栈、队列)
3. 计算机组成原理
- 主题句:了解计算机的内部结构和组成,对于理解计算机工作原理至关重要。
- 知识点:
- 计算机硬件系统(CPU、内存、输入输出设备)
- 中央处理器(CPU)的工作原理
- 存储系统(硬盘、内存、缓存)
- 输入输出系统
4. 操作系统
- 主题句:操作系统是计算机系统的核心,掌握其基本原理对于深入学习计算机科学至关重要。
- 知识点:
- 进程管理
- 内存管理
- 文件系统
- 网络操作系统
5. 数据库系统
- 主题句:数据库系统是现代计算机科学中不可或缺的一部分,本章节将介绍其基本概念和原理。
- 知识点:
- 关系型数据库模型
- SQL语言基础
- 数据库设计原则
- 数据库系统架构
6. 计算机网络
- 主题句:计算机网络是实现信息共享和资源互访的基础设施,本章节将探讨其基本原理。
- 知识点:
- 网络体系结构(OSI七层模型)
- 网络协议(TCP/IP)
- 网络设备(路由器、交换机)
- 网络安全
7. 软件工程
- 主题句:软件工程是确保软件开发质量的重要学科,本章节将介绍其基本原理和方法。
- 知识点:
- 软件开发生命周期
- 软件需求分析
- 软件设计原则
- 软件测试方法
8. 计算机图形学
- 主题句:计算机图形学是计算机科学与艺术相结合的领域,本章节将介绍其基本概念和技术。
- 知识点:
- 图形硬件和软件基础
- 图形变换
- 图形绘制算法
- 三维图形处理
9. 人工智能
- 主题句:人工智能是计算机科学的前沿领域,本章节将介绍其基本原理和应用。
- 知识点:
- 机器学习基础
- 深度学习
- 自然语言处理
- 人工智能伦理
10. 计算机安全
- 主题句:随着信息技术的发展,计算机安全变得尤为重要,本章节将介绍其基本概念和技术。
- 知识点:
- 计算机安全基本原理
- 加密技术
- 认证与授权
- 网络安全攻防
通过以上对大学计算机课程必备课本目录与知识点的全面解析,相信读者能够对计算机科学有一个更为清晰的认识,为今后的学习打下坚实的基础。
